## Escalation: Kiosk Watchdog

The Pinemarten kiosk app runs a watchdog that restarts the UI after three unresponsive heartbeats. If a kiosk restarts more than five times in an hour, the watchdog locks it into maintenance mode and pages the on-call rotation automatically. New team members should not override maintenance mode without approval from the Fieldworks lead. If paging fails or you need guidance outside rotation hours, escalate by emailing the kiosk platform group at the address below.

alerts address for bajop-yahog: istwyn@lumiclabs.internal

Handover note — Crumbwheel order cutoffs.

Welcome aboard. The bakery cutoff rule in Crumbwheel closes same-day orders at 14:00 local to each storefront, not UTC — this has bitten us twice. Holiday overrides live in the calendar service and take precedence silently, so always check there first when a cutoff looks wrong. To unlock the calendar service's admin console after a restart, enter the recovery passphrase below.

vault phrase of bagap-bahaf = silion-pelox-sorox-casdor-quenwyn-fraax-eliox-praael-kelion-quenvan-kasox-rusael-norius-belvan

### Runbook: Account Recovery — Inventory Reconciliation (Stocklantern)

For the weekly eng sync: the Stocklantern reconciliation job runs nightly under a dedicated service account. If that account is disabled, reconciliation silently skips and warehouse counts drift, so check the Ambergate job monitor first. Recovery involves re-enabling the account, rotating its token, and replaying the missed window with `reconcile --since`. All steps require a second engineer's sign-off. When the recovery console prompts you, enter the passphrase below.

vault phrase of kawep-tahog = ulaix-briath

**FAQ: What changed with the payroll export format?**

Short version: Tallybridge moved from the old fixed-width export to a delimited format starting this cycle. Customers on the legacy importer will see column mismatches — point them at the migration guide and they're usually fine. If someone insists on regenerating a past export in the old format, that tooling now lives behind the archived-exports vault, so only escalate when truly needed. To open the archived-exports vault, use the recovery passphrase below.

unlock words, bawip-taduf: casix-belael-norael-silwyn